摘要
以没食子酸为标准品,使用酚试剂,采用分光光度法对青果(Fructus canarii)多酚的含量进行检测。结果表明,酚试剂用量为1.5 mL,与6 mL质量分数10%的Na2CO3溶液混合,30℃反应60 min,于765 nm处测定吸光度,没食子酸浓度在0.5~2.5 mg/L范围内与吸光度有良好的线性关系,回归方程为y=0.121 2x+0.004 0。该方法能较准确地定量分析青果多酚含量,具有简便、快速、稳定,重现性好的优点。
The polyphenol in Fructus canarii was detected by spectrophotometry with Folin-Ciocaheu reagent and gallic acid as standard. The results showed that the best detection condition was that mixing 1.5 mL Folin-Ciocalteu reagent with 6 mL 10% Na2CO3 (m/V), and then reacting for 60 min at 30℃ and detected at 765 nm. The linear range of standard curve was 0.5-2.5 mg/L in which the regression equation was y=0.121 2x+0.004 0. The method was simple, fast, stable and reproducible for detecting polyphenol in Fructus canarii.
